137 thousand 401 houses were sold in Turkey in October

In October, 137 thousand 401 houses were sold throughout Turkey. Housing sales to foreigners increased by 12.1% in October compared to the same month of the previous year and became 5 thousand 893. Iranian citizens took the first place with 1265 houses.

Housing sales to foreigners in Turkey increased by 12.1% in October compared to the same month of the previous year, and rose to 5,893.

Turkish Statistical Institute announced the house sales statistics for the month of October.

Accordingly, a total of 137 thousand 401 houses were sold in Turkey in October. During this period, foreigners bought 5,893 houses. Housing sales to foreigners increased by 12.1% on an annual basis in October.

The share of house sales to foreigners in total house sales was 4.3%.

In the housing sales to foreigners, Istanbul took the first place in October with 2,464 sales. This city was followed by Antalya with 1385 sales and Ankara with 359 sales, respectively.

In the January-October period, house sales to foreigners increased by 38% compared to the same period of the previous year and became 43 thousand 372.

In October, Iranian citizens bought 1265 houses from Turkey. The citizens of Iran were followed by the citizens of Iraq with 926 residences and the citizens of the Russian Federation with 543 residences, respectively.

THERE WAS A RISE IN MORTGAGED HOUSING SALES

Mortgaged house sales in October increased by 9.7% compared to the same month of the previous year and became 28 thousand 49. The share of mortgaged sales in total housing sales was recorded as 20.4%.

Mortgaged house sales in the January-October period, on the other hand, decreased by 60.7% compared to the same period of the previous year and became 209 thousand 904.

OTHER HOUSING SALES INCREASED

Other house sales increased by 16.3% in October compared to the same month of the previous year and rose to 109 thousand 352. The share of other sales in total house sales was 79.6%.

Other house sales in the January-October period were recorded as 876 thousand 635 with an increase of 17.4% compared to the same period of the previous year.

The number of first-hand house sales in Turkey increased by 13.4% in October compared to the same month of the previous year and became 41 thousand 914. The share of first-hand housing sales in total housing sales was calculated as 30.5%.

First-hand house sales decreased by 16.9% in the January-October period compared to the same period of the previous year, and amounted to 329 thousand 70.

Second-hand house sales across the country increased by 15.6% in October compared to the same month of the previous year and rose to 95 thousand 487. The share of second-hand housing sales in total housing sales was 69.5%.

Second-hand house sales were recorded as 757 thousand 469 with a decrease of 14.4% in the January-October period compared to the same period of the previous year.
